A fix is available
APAR status
Closed as program error.
Error description
Migrated from CICS TS 5.2 to CICS TS 5.5 and start getting AEXZ abends for an EXEC CICS WEB SEND POST FROM() ACTION(EXPECT) command. DFHWBCL has to determine the HTTP level of the server before trying to send an Expects header. This is done by sending an options request to the server. In this case the server closed the connection after responding to the options request DFHWBCL did not handle the closure correctly and failed to automatically reconnect. The HTTP headers for the actual application request are sent over a closed connection. This then leads to an AEXZ abend. . Additional Symptoms and Keywords: Upgrade2CICS55 Upgrade2CICS56
Local fix
n/a
Problem summary
**************************************************************** * USERS AFFECTED: All CICS users. * **************************************************************** * PROBLEM DESCRIPTION: EXEC CICS WEB SEND FROM() with the * * ACTION(EXPECT) option abends AEXZ. * **************************************************************** An EXEC CICS WEB SEND FROM() with the ACTION(EXPECT) option is issued. ACTION(EXPECT) is an HTTP 1.1 only function so CICS sends an OPTIONS request to the server to determine the HTTP version. The server responds and the connection is closed. CICS doesn't handle the response correctly and fails to re-establish the connection. The application request is then sent on a closed connection which leads to the AEXZ abend. Keywords: abendAEXZ wbcl_exception wbcl_body_truncated
Problem conclusion
DFHWBCL has been changed to handle the OPTIONS response correctly. FIXCAT: SWPSP/K
Temporary fix
Comments
APAR Information
APAR number
PH25660
Reported component name
CICS TS Z/OS V5
Reported component ID
5655Y0400
Reported release
200
Status
CLOSED PER
PE
NoPE
HIPER
NoHIPER
Special Attention
NoSpecatt / Xsystem
Submitted date
2020-05-21
Closed date
2020-09-30
Last modified date
2024-04-22
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
UI71847 UI71848
Modules/Macros
DFHWBCL
Fix information
Fixed component name
CICS TS Z/OS V5
Fixed component ID
5655Y0400
Applicable component levels
Fix is available
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.
[{"Business Unit":{"code":"BU048","label":"IBM Software"},"Product":{"code":"SSGMGV","label":"CICS Transaction Server"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"5.5","Line of Business":{"code":"LOB70","label":"Z TPS"}}]
Document Information
Modified date:
22 April 2024